SINGAPORE PASSPORT APPLICATION AND EXTENSION

BioPass (New Singapore International Passport)

All Singapore passports issued from 15 Aug 2006 will be biometrically-enabled (BioPass).

Singaporeans holding the current non-biometric machine-readable passports may wish to apply for the new BioPass to enjoy visa-free travel to the United States of America (USA) under the US Visa Waiver Programme.

You may wish to apply for a Singapore International Passport (i.e. BioPass) using the applications form (Form IMM E11 (OS) and Form P 28.3) which are available at http://www.ica.gov.sg/e_services_overview.aspx?pageid=283&secid=280.  The completed application forms can then be submitted either in person or through a proxy at the Consulate General.

Validity

The new BioPass is valid for 5 years. If your existing passport carries a remaining validity of 9 months or less, the remaining validity of your passport will be carried over to your new passport. In such a case, your new passport will have a validity period of 5 years, plus the remaining validity of your old passport. However, if your existing passport is more than 9 months' validity, your new passport will have a validity period of 5 years and 9 months.

Passport Extension

Extension of passport validity are not allowed on the new Singapore Biometric Passport (BioPass).  BioPass holders whose passports are running out of pages or reaching its full validity have to apply for a new passport.

Singapore Citizens may be holding a machine-readable passport with validity of less than 10 years (for passports issued before 1 April 2005) or 5 years (for passports issued from 1 April 2005 onwards).  [Note: Passports issued before 15 Aug 2006 to male citizens aged between 11 and 16½ years are valid for 2 years or till the holder reaches 17½ years old, whichever is earlier.]  These passport may be extended.

NS-Liable Males

With the introduction of BioPass, the Ministry of Defence (MINDEF) has decided to remove passport controls for NS-liable males and allow them to be issued with passports of full validity.

Exit control measures however continue to be relevant and necessary. MINDEF has decided to extend exit permit requirements, which currently affect only males aged 16½ to enlistment, to males aged 13 to below 16½.

To avoid inconveniencing those who make short overseas trips during vacations, an exit permit will only be required for overseas trips of 3 months or longer.  To apply for Exit Permit, please visit MINDEF website at
http://www.ns.sg.

Those who require exit permit of 2 years or longer will be required to furnish a bond. This bonding requirement is similar to the current arrangement where security in the form of Banker's Guarantee must be furnished. The amount of the security bond is S$75,000 or 50% of the combined gross annual income of both parents for the preceding year, whichever is higher. The monetary bond requirement for male citizens who accompany their parents on overseas employment may be waived and they be bonded by deed with two sureties.

There will be no change to the exit permit and bonding requirements for NS-liable males aged 16½ to enlistment.

Important Notice

Most countries require passports to be valid for at least 6 months on the date of entry. You are advised to renew your passport early.
